Over the last 24 hours, Kuwaiti bomb disposal teams responded to 21 reports of falling shrapnel originating from defensive intercepts of Iranian hostile actions, raising the total to 442 incidents since the start of the conflict. The Kuwaiti Interior Ministry activated civil defense sirens four times, bringing total siren alerts to 98, aimed at warning and protecting the population from potential harm. The response efforts involved immediate dispatch of specialized teams to secure affected areas and ensure the safety of both citizens and residents.
